Nurturing curiosity: FAO teams up with the United Nations in New York for UN Kids Day 2026

The FAO Liaison Office with the United Nations in New York took part in United Nations Kids Day 2026, an annual event in New York that offers children aged 5 to 10 the opportunity to learn about the work of the United Nations and its entities.

During the day, which was attended by around 400 children, FAO introduced them to the four betters, healthy diets, and the right to food through games, activities and FAOs activity books. Children were inspired to see their daily actions and choices as ways to make a difference, no matter how small they were. We can all do our part - working hand in hand - to build a brighter future for all.

FAO also contributed to a storytelling session alongside colleagues from across the UN. The sessions aimed to spark curiosity and action, showing children their potential as agents of change.

FAO's participation in UN Kids Day reflects its commitment to engaging with and empowering future generations.
